Mercury at Aphelion
Mercury's 88-day orbit around the Sun will carry it to its furthest point to the Sun – its aphelion – at a distance of 0.47 AU.
Mars at Perihelion
On this day, Mars it closest to the Sun in its orbit.
Summer Solstice
The summer solstice is the day when the Sun appears to reach its highest point in the sky during the year - it marks the start of summer in the Northern Hemisphere.
Moon at Apogee
On this day, the Moon will be at its most distant point from Earth in its orbit.
